The Dieffenbachia Compacta, Perfecta, commonly known as Dumb Cane, is a stunning houseplant that boasts lush, green foliage with striking white and cream variegation. This tropical beauty is native to the rainforests of Central and South America, making it a perfect addition to your indoor garden. Its compact size makes it ideal for small spaces, while its air-purifying qualities enhance your home environment.
What sets the Dieffenbachia Compacta apart is its ability to thrive in low-light conditions, making it an excellent choice for beginners and seasoned plant enthusiasts alike. This resilient plant not only adds a touch of elegance to any room but also contributes to improved indoor air quality by filtering out harmful toxins.
Special features of the Dieffenbachia Compacta include its unique ability to adapt to various light conditions and its low maintenance requirements. With proper care, this plant can grow up to 3 feet tall, making it a striking focal point in any space.
Dieffenbachia Compacta plays a significant role in improving indoor air quality by removing toxins such as formaldehyde and benzene. Its ability to thrive in low-light conditions makes it an eco-friendly choice for urban dwellers looking to bring a touch of nature indoors.

Ah, the infamous Dieffenbachia! While it’s a beauty, it comes with a warning label. This plant contains calcium oxalate crystals, which can cause irritation if chewed or ingested. So, if you have a penchant for nibbling on houseplants, this one’s not for you. Keep it out of reach of pets and kids, and you’ll enjoy its beauty without the drama.

Beware, the Dieffenbachia Compacta can attract some uninvited guests! Spider mites, aphids, and mealybugs are just a few of the pests that might try to crash your plant party. Keep an eye out for these little intruders and treat them with insecticidal soap or neem oil. After all, you want your plant to thrive, not become a buffet for bugs!
The Dieffenbachia Compacta is a bit of a light snob. It thrives in bright, indirect light but can tolerate lower light conditions. Just don’t leave it in the dark for too long, or it might start sulking and dropping leaves. Think of it as your friend who needs a little sunshine to stay cheerful.
When it comes to soil, the Dieffenbachia Compacta is not picky, but it does prefer a well-draining mix. A blend of potting soil, perlite, and peat moss will keep it happy and healthy. Avoid heavy soils that retain too much moisture, or you might find your plant drowning in its own home.
Want your Dieffenbachia to grow like a weed? Feed it with a balanced liquid fertilizer every month during the growing season. It’s like giving your plant a protein shake—just the boost it needs to thrive! But don’t overdo it; too much fertilizer can lead to burnt leaves, and nobody wants that.
Is your Dieffenbachia Compacta outgrowing its pot? Time for a repotting party! Choose a pot that’s one size larger and refresh the soil. This will give your plant room to stretch its roots and continue its fabulous growth. Just be gentle; you don’t want to break any roots in the process.

The key to a happy Dieffenbachia Compacta is a consistent watering schedule. Allow the top inch of soil to dry out before giving it a drink. Overwatering is a common mistake, so channel your inner Goldilocks—make sure it’s not too wet, not too dry, but just right!
Ready to plant your Dieffenbachia Compacta? Choose a pot with drainage holes to prevent waterlogging. Fill it with a well-draining soil mix, and gently place your plant in. Give it a little pat and some love, and watch it flourish. It’s like planting a little piece of happiness in your home!
